Output 77b5e398565e8fa36c1352c31286f1f23d88b2ce95d66d00914f0fe203492034:1

value
1945730074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52bfb86dc79d175890e2be8681e3c0b0b93747aa OP_EQUALVERIFY OP_CHECKSIG
address
18YY5hXe47KHUKNDY1dmFxbBaSHW4npA1B
transaction
77b5e398565e8fa36c1352c31286f1f23d88b2ce95d66d00914f0fe203492034
spent
true